Counselling Contract
​
An assessment, carried out with parents/guardians prior to starting Play Therapy sessions, will establish the number of sessions offered initially to your child; this would normally be a minimum of 12 sessions with a review after 8 sessions. During the review meeting it will be decided whether to extend the number of Play Therapy sessions. We will continue Play Therapy sessions until we feel that our objectives have been completed, unless extenuating circumstances mean that this is not possible. If this is the case, we will ensure that an appropriate number of sessions allow for a well-handled ending.

Confidentiality
​
I follow PTUK’s confidentiality policy, which means that information obtained is only what is considered necessary and will be stored in a locked filing cabinet in a safe location. Information is only shared on a need-to-know basis if it would help the therapy process, permission will be obtained from parents/guardians before any information is shared. Any information shared by the child in a session is confidential and may only be shared with the parent/guardian with the child’s permission. The only exception is child protection issues, which would be shared with other professionals following the school’s Child Protection Policy. In these cases, the child will be made aware of what is being shared.
Supervision
​
All professionals working therapeutically with children and/or families must have regular supervision to support good practice as required by PTUK. All clients are presented under a pseudonym to protect their identity.
